(d) Relations with Specialized Agencies The Conference — Approves the Agreement between the International Labour Organization and the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ations relating to co-operation between the two agencies ; Requests the Director-General to notify the International Labour Organization of such approval and to file the Agreement with the United Nations as provided by Article 10, paragraph 2, of the Agreement. (e) Relations with International Nongovernmental Organizations The Conference — Having taken note of the application of the International Chamber of Commerce to be brought into consultative relationship with FAO, Decides that the privileges to be granted to that Organization shall be those of Category I, as defined in the resolution adopted on the matter by the Second Session of the Conference. (/) Regional Offices The Conference — Authorizes the Director-General to proceed with the work of establishing regional offices; Instructs him to prepare forthwith, in consultation with member countries and other international bodies, plans for the approval of the council whereby offices may be established in each principal region, and more especially in Latin America, Europe, the Middle East (Near East), and Asia; and in doing so, to take advantage of any regional machinery when planning and carrying out technical missions with a view to attaining the highest possible efficiency at a minimum cost. (g) Accounts of the Organization The Conference — Approves, in conformity with Financial Regulation XX, paragraph 4, the audited accounts of the first financial year ending 30 June, 1946, and the audited accounts for the period 1 July to 31 December, 1946. (h) Payment of Contributions The Conference — Notes with concern (1) that nine member nations have not yet paid, either in whole or in part, their contributions for the first financial year and (2) that at the end of July, 1947, a substantial part of the contributions for the second financial year still remain to be collected; Urges member nations that have not yet done so to take immediate steps to have their contributions paid at the earliest possible moment, and in any case not later than 31 December, 1947 ;
